Having reissued the dB's first two albums, 'Stands for Decibels' and 'Repercussion', it's only natural and right that we delve back into their catalog for 'Like This', their third album originally released on the Bearsville label in 1984. By now, Chris Stamey had left the band for a solo career, but Peter Holsapple, Will Rigby and Gene Holder were still going strong (with production help by ex-Waitress Chris Butler)...in fact, Holsapple declares in the notes that this is probably his favorite dB's album. It's definitely more straight-ahead than the first two, as Holsapple's gorgeous songwriting comes to the fore. Another essential power pop exclusive from 'Collectors' Choice'! Includes 'A Spy in the House of Love; Rendezvous; New Gun in Town; On the Battlefront; White Train; Love Is for Lovers; She Got Soul; Spitting in the Wind; Lonely Is (as Lonely Does); Not Cool', and 'Amplifier', plus a couple of bonus tracks: 'Darby Hall' and an extended remix of 'A Spy in the House of Love'!
